Jobbeskrivelse for front-end-udvikler

Udgivet: Sidst opdateret:
Skabelon til jobbeskrivelse for front-end-udvikler

Hvad er frontend-udvikling, og hvad laver en frontend-udvikler? Vi har alle svarene i denne skabelon til jobbeskrivelse for front-end-udvikler.

Front-end webudvikler: roller og ansvarsområder

Front-end-udviklere fokuserer på det visuelle layout, brugergrænseflade/interaktion og brugeroplevelse. De skaber komponenter og funktioner, som brugeren får direkte adgang til via et websteds front-end. Front-end-udviklerens ansvarsområder omfatter alt det på et websted, som brugerne kan se, røre ved, klikke på og bruge, herunder UX og UI af webstedet eller webapplikationen. I deres arbejde omsætter de wireframes fra designere til fuldt ud realiserede brugergrænseflader ved at skabe de knapper, billeder, links og sider, som alle skal fungere effektivt, præcist og hurtigt, så brugeren kan udføre en bestemt opgave.

Nedenfor kan du finde en skabelon til en jobbeskrivelse for front-end-udvikler. Denne skabelon indeholder eksempler på roller og ansvarsområder og færdigheder, som er typiske for en sådan stilling. Denne skabelon er naturligvis kun et grundlæggende udgangspunkt - vi anbefaler kraftigt, at du tilpasser skabelonen, så den passer til netop det job, som du ønsker at besætte. Bemærk venligst, at i overensstemmelse med god praksis viser denne skabelon til jobbeskrivelse for front-end-udvikler én måde at beskrive den person, du søger, startende fra mere generelle krav, over mere specifikke krav og sluttende med eventuelle valgfrie ekstra færdigheder eller erfaring.

Skabelon til jobbeskrivelse for front-end-udvikler

Er du den rette?

Vi søger en erfaren front-end udvikler til at indgå i vores produktteam. Du har sandsynligvis 3 til 5 års relevant erhvervserfaring som webudvikler, UI-udvikler, JavaScript-ekspert eller front-end ingeniør enten i kommercielle projekter eller open source-projekter.

Du skal både være teknisk dygtig og have et godt øje for design og UI/UX. I denne rolle vil du yde et væsentligt bidrag til at omsætte vores kunders behov og brugernes forventninger til interaktive webapps. Du er en enestående problemløser med gode kommunikationsevner og er i stand til at optimere vores applikation både teknisk og med hensyn til at levere den bedste brugeroplevelse. Dine ansvarsområder vil omfatte oversættelse af design wireframes til den kode, der skal producere visuelle elementer i applikationen.

Du vil hele tiden arbejde sammen med UI/UX-designteamet for at bygge bro mellem grafisk design og teknisk implementering og spille en aktiv rolle i definitionen af, hvordan programmet ser ud, og hvordan det fungerer. Ideelt set skal du kunne demonstrere praktisk erfaring med at anvende aktuelle tendenser og bedste praksis inden for front-end arkitektur, herunder optimering af ydeevne, tilgængelighed og brugervenlighed.

Du har sandsynligvis en selvdreven og samvittighedsfuld mentalitet med en forpligtelse til at skabe innovationer gennem arbejde af høj kvalitet.

Ansvarsområder for front end-udvikler

Generelt vil du arbejde tæt sammen med designteamet, produktstyring og udviklingsteams for at skabe elegante, brugbare, responsive og interaktive grænseflader på tværs af flere enheder. Du vil derfor:

  • løbende at få feedback fra brugere, kunder og kolleger
  • overvåge appens ydeevne, holde øje med trafikfald i forbindelse med problemer med brugervenlighed på webstedet og afhjælpe eventuelle problemer
  • skrive funktionelle kravdokumenter og vejledninger
  • skabe kvalitetsmockups og prototyper, der sikrer grafiske standarder af høj kvalitet og konsistens i brandet
  • omdanne UI/UX-designs til prototyper og skabe fremragende interaktioner ud fra design
  • at skrive genanvendelig kode og biblioteker (med tilhørende dokumentation) efter en standard, der gør det hurtigt og nemt at vedligeholde koden i fremtiden
  • optimering af applikationer for maksimal hastighed
  • optimere applikationer for maksimal skalerbarhed
  • udvikle nye funktioner eller vedligeholde gamle funktioner
  • samarbejde med backend-udviklere og webdesignere for at forbedre brugervenligheden
  • hjælpe back-end-udviklere med kodning og fejlfinding
  • holde sig ajour med nye teknologier
  • [Tilføj eventuelle andre front end-udvikleransvarsområder, der er relevante]

Du er perfekt til denne rolle, hvis du:

  • du kan lide udfordringen ved at deltage i komplekse tekniske projekter og levere iterative løsninger, der giver værdi på hvert trin på vejen
  • at klare sig godt i et miljø med et højt tempo og bidrage til et optimalt flow i et design/teknologimiljø, der ændrer sig hurtigt
  • du kan lide at arbejde tæt sammen med partnere på tværs af virksomheden og i dit team for at løse problemer
  • er en god kommunikator, der er fokuseret på at finde og levere løsninger, fremme meningsfulde diskussioner og skabe konsensus
  • du nyder virkelig at dele din viden med andre

Færdigheder og kvalifikationer hos front end-udvikler

Du skal kunne dokumentere:

  • indgående kendskab til HTML5 og CSS3
  • ekspertkompetencer i JavaScript eller TypeScript
  • et højt niveau af færdighed med JavaScript-rammer som jQuery, Angular 2+ [Tilføj venligst andre rammer, biblioteker eller anden teknologi relateret til din udviklingsstack]
  • stor erfaring med UI layouts, SASS, LESS, Bootstrap og CSS GRID-systemet
  • solid erfaring med at bruge en kompleks REST API fra klientsiden
  • en solid forståelse af kompatibilitetsproblemer på tværs af browsere og måder at arbejde udenom dem på
  • godt kendskab til og praktisk erfaring med build/konfigurationsstyring på klientsiden
  • godt kendskab til og praktisk erfaring med testværktøjer som Webpack, Jasmine, Karma osv.
  • god forståelse for værktøjer til versionering af kode, såsom Git, Mercurial eller SVN
  • god forståelse for asynkron forespørgselshåndtering, delvise sideopdateringer og Ajax
  • betydelig erfaring med fejlfinding ved hjælp af JavaScript-baserede værktøjer som Chrome Developer Console
  • en vis eksponering for Continuous Integration/Delivery pipeline til cloud, herunder Jenkins, SonarQube, Docker osv.
  • grundlæggende kendskab til grafiske værktøjer som GIMP eller Photoshop, så du kan foretage små ændringer på billeder

Følgende vil også være et stort plus for en front end-udvikler:

  • kendskab til Ember.js og Ruby
  • en vis eksponering for full-stack-udvikling
  • en god forståelse af SEO-principper, så du kan sikre, at vores applikation overholder disse principper

Slut på front end developer job skabelon

Hvorfor er det vigtigt at få den rigtige skabelon til jobbeskrivelse for front-end udviklere?

Når du skriver jobbeskrivelsen, skal du forsøge at få både selve jobbet og arbejdet i din virksomhed til at lyde så attraktivt og interessant som muligt. Frem for alt skal du være så klar som muligt om, hvad du forventer af en ansøger.

Færdigheder som front-end udvikler

Som regel betyder front-end, at udviklere skal være fortrolige med HTML-kode (sandsynligvis HTML5), styling med CSS (sandsynligvis CSS3) og gøre alt interaktivt med JavaScript. JS Frameworks som Angular, React og Backbone er derfor meget efterspurgte.

Ansvarsområder for front-end-udvikler

Front-end-udviklere står over for nogle unikke udfordringer og muligheder. Først og fremmest skal de arbejde sammen med alle på holdet, hvilket giver dem en bredere rolle i udviklingsprocessen end backend-udviklere. Front-end webudviklere kan derfor ikke kun kode, men er også folk, der kan sætte sig ned med visuelle og UX-designere og løse større udfordringer som en del af et team.

Jeg håber, at du finder denne skabelon med roller og ansvarsområder for front end-udvikler nyttig!

Vi har også en række ressourcer til ansættelse af udviklere, herunder lønbenchmarks:

Del indlæg

Få mere at vide om ansættelse af teknologiske medarbejdere

Tilmeld dig vores Learning Hub for at få nyttig viden direkte i din indbakke.

Kontroller og udvikl kodningsevner uden problemer.

Se DevSkiller-produkterne i aktion.

Sikkerhedscertificeringer og overholdelse. Vi sørger for, at dine data er sikre og beskyttede.

DevSkiller-logo TalentBoost-logo TalentScore-logo